In 2022, 1 barrel of Azerbaijani "Azeri Light" oil was sold on the world market at an average of 103.6 US dollars.
This is stated in the "Annual report on the execution of the state budget for 2022".
According to the document, this is up by 44.7% from the average price in 2021 and up by 21.8% from an index taken as the basis for the revision of the state budget for 2022.
"Amid the uncertainty prevailing in the global economy and commodity markets, oil and natural gas prices exceeded forecasts. High energy prices were mainly due to the emergence of military clashes between Russia and Ukraine, the imposition of sanctions, export and price restrictions due to the conflict, as well as the achievement of an agreement between OPEC+ countries to reduce the level of oil production," the report notes.
